Mount Kilimanjaro, standing at an impressive 5,895 meters (19,341 feet), is the tallest mountain in Africa and a crown jewel of Tanzania. This iconic peak, often called the “Roof of Africa,” is a dormant volcano comprising three distinct cones: Kibo, Mawenzi, and Shira. Its snow-capped summit contrasts beautifully with the surrounding savannah, making it one of the most striking natural landmarks in the world. Mount Kilimanjaro is renowned for its unique ecological diversity, with five distinct climate zones ranging from lush rainforests to alpine deserts and icy glaciers, providing a stunning variety of landscapes for adventurers to explore.
Climbing Mount Kilimanjaro is a bucket-list experience for many, attracting trekkers from across the globe. Unlike other major peaks, it doesn’t require technical climbing skills, making it accessible to those with determination and proper preparation. Trekkers can choose from several routes, such as the Machame, Marangu, or Lemosho, each offering unique challenges and scenic views. Beyond the physical challenge, the journey offers a deep connection with nature and the local Chagga culture. Reaching Uhuru Peak, the mountain’s highest point, is a life-changing achievement, offering breathtaking sunrises and unparalleled views that reward every step of the climb.
